<description><![CDATA[Mr. Athar Siddiqui, the Managing Director of Showa Tsusho Co Ltd., in Japan is one of the prominent and Senior Pakistani Businessman in Japan. Used car exports is one of the largest business in which Pakistanis are integral part in the far eastern country of Rising Sun, the Japan.<br/>Mr. Athar Siddiqui views reflects voices of all Pakistani used car exporters in Japan. Mr. Siddiqui brought up suggestion to create an international used car market in Pakistan and majority of Pakistani used car exporters in Japan demanding for it, since many years.<br/>Mr. Siddiqui proposals should be considered at highest level in the government of Pakistan as it will brings billions of Dollars investment in country.<br/>We urged government of Pakistan to listen valuable suggestions and views of overseas Pakistanis so that we can bridge chances to contribute for a prosperous Pakistan.<br/>Please Click on POD at Speaker Tab to listen interview or any other program.<br/>To submit your opinion or views please click comments and follow the instructions.<br/>

<description><![CDATA[Mr. Jameel Ahmad is one of the pioneer Halal Food businessman in Japan and owner of FEAST Co., Ltd. He began this business in Japan in early 90s and continue seeking ways to bring Pakistani products in the Japanese market.<br>He urged Pakistani government, Embassy of Pakistan in Japan and Pakistani exporters to promote Pakistani products in Japan. But he also emphasized needs to improve quality and packing of Pakistani goods and products.<br>Halal food business is expending in Japan as more and more Muslims from Malaysia, Indonesia, African continent and Middle East coming into Japan and number of Japanese Muslim is also on increasing. Mr. Jameel Ahmad is willing to gain opportunities in this business.<br>He openly speak about bitterness of lack of Pakistani products in Japan and want some positive steps from the government of Pakistan and the Embassy of Pakistan in Tokyo.<br>
